COPIER►BEFORE USING THE MACHINE AS A COPIER 6 Tap the [Start] key to start copying. When making only one set of copies, you do not need to specify the number of copies. • To cancel all settings, tap the [CA] key. When the [CA] key is tapped, all settings selected to that point are cleared and you will return to the base screen. • To cancel copying, tap the [Cancel Copy] key. • To make two or more sets of copies: Tap the copies display key to specify the number of copies. This is used to set the maximum number that can be entered for the number of copies (number of continuous copies). Any number from 1 to 9999 can be specified. Default settings for copying Set in "Default Settings" of "Copy Settings" in the System Settings. You can set a default value for each copy setting. Initial Status Settings selected with these settings apply to all functions of the machine (not just the copy function). The copier settings are reset to the initial state when the [Power] button is turned on, when the [CA] key is tapped, or when the auto clear interval has elapsed. These settings are used to change the default settings for copy mode. The following settings can be changed: Item Image Orientation Paper Tray Exposure Type Copy Ratio 2-Sided Copy Original Binding Description Specify the original orientation. Specify the paper tray that is selected by default. Configure default exposure mode settings. Specify the copy ratio that is selected by default. Configure the 2-sided mode settings that are selected by default. If this setting is used to change the default setting for the duplex function to any setting other than "1-Side to 1-Side" and the duplex function or automatic document feeder fails or is disabled, the setting will revert to "1-Side to 1-Side". Set the original binding in 2-Sided copy. 2-7
